[jira] [Updated] (HADOOP-15872) ABFS: getFileStatus should only require execute permission on the parent folders

> The ABFS implementation of getFileStatus currently requires read permission.  According to HDFS permissions guide, it should only require execute on the parent folders (traversal access).
